‘Cordelia’, a movie by ace filmmaker Tunde Kelani, is set to premiere in cinemas nationwide on July 18.
Written by Femi Osofisan, ‘Cordelia’ tells the compelling story of a disillusioned professor whose life takes an unexpected turn when he shelters a wounded student during a period of intense campus unrest and political chaos following a failed military coup.
Unbeknownst to him, the young woman he rescues is the daughter of a key figure in the botched coup, plunging the professor and his family into a whirlwind of danger, intrigue, and unrelenting turmoil.
Set against a backdrop of simmering tension, hidden betrayals, and the weight of unspoken truths, ‘Cordelia’ promises to be a riveting exploration of morality, sacrifice, and the far-reaching consequences of a single act of kindness.
The film features an all-star cast, including Omowunmi Dada, Yvonne Jegede, Femi Adebayo, William Benson, Bassey Keppy Ekpeyong, and Kelechi Udegbe, with Kelani serving as both producer and director.
A legendary figure in Nigerian cinema, Kelani is celebrated for his dedication to adapting literary works into visually stunning films.
With a career spanning over four decades, he has consistently championed Nigeria’s rich cultural heritage, particularly that of the Yoruba people.
Some of his works include ‘Ko s’egbe’, ‘O le ku’, ‘Thunder Bolt’, ‘The Narrow Path’, ‘White Handkerchief’, ‘Maami’, ‘Ayinla’ and ‘Dazzling Mirage’.
